Output 42173b33c7f08db56c21d1a147ea876de40806776bbaa03bfde15c18f9306a2d:0

value
475489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ec61de4b84a9538620ddbe8f0b5224698604ca08 OP_EQUAL
address
3PEtdpvwRdHre2XbKENnx6Do5EvFeGfK2D
transaction
42173b33c7f08db56c21d1a147ea876de40806776bbaa03bfde15c18f9306a2d